Forbes – What’s Hot at CES (Top 5 Disruptive Technology Companies)

It’s not easy for a new vendor to break into the white-hot smartphone market, but that’s what Saygus is trying to do. Their Android smartphone has plenty of bells and whistles, but its most disruptive capability is its HD-WiFi capacity.

This phone is able to beam high-definition video to any television equipped with the appropriate dongle. Now consumers can use their smartphone to control their streaming video service while watching the video on the large screen.

Add a PowerPoint viewer to create a powerful business tool. Drive any WiFi-enabled projector from a phone, even when the presentation contains high resolution video. Saygus currently supports display mirroring, with extended display capability on the drawing board.
